Prayers said, rolls called.
Minuts of the last sederunt read.
The proces the laird of Clackmannan against his creditors being called, and none of them compearing, protection was granted to him to the nixt session of parliament inclusive.
The ratification of a charter in favors of the earle of Marchmont past.
The act for the imposition on all foraigne ships read the second tyme, and, after severall amendments made thereon, it was put to the vote approve or not, and carried approve, and tutched with the scepter by her majesty's high commissioner in the usuall manner.
The parliament, haveing heard the report of the commission to whom it was remitted to inquire farder into the complaint given in by John Smith against the generall muster master, and they both being present, John Smith craved that John Forbes, agent to Collonell Hill's regiment then in the garison of Inverlochie, might be examined on the interrogators given in by him, who, being called, was examined and thereafter the farder inquiry in this whole affair, both in that regiment and all the other regiments since the time the generall muster master got his commission, and all the muster masters, deputs and agents for the regiments since the revolution, remitted to the commission, with power to them to call and examine witnesses and likewayes to call for papers, writes and documents for clearing this whole mater, and to report next session of parliament.
Petitions Lieutennent Smith and Cornet Henry Montgomery, craveing arrears dew to them, read, and remitted to the commission.
Act anent the misapplying the publick fonds read, and a first reading ordered to be marked thereon and to be printed.
Act for armeing the countrey read, and a first reading ordered to be marked thereon and to be printed.
The parliament procceded to take the affair of the plot into consideratione. It was moved that since there is no sufficient documents but only copys of papers produced, her majesty be addressed to send to the nixt session of parliament the principall papers relateing thereto. And it was resolved, nemine contradicente, that there be a draught of ane address brought in from the parliament to the queen, to lay before the nixt session of parliament all the principall papers relating to the plot, and to send the evidences, persones and witnesses to appear at the nixt session of parliament.
The lord chancellor, by order of the lord high commissioner, adjourned the parliament till Munday nixt at ten a cloak.
